PREPARED FOR ACTION

“Therefore, preparing your minds for action, and being sober-minded, set your hope fully on the grace that will be brought to you at the revelation of Jesus Christ,” 1 Peter 1:13 ESV. This verse is so instructive and powerful! These simple phrases, “Prepare for Action,” “Be Sober-Minded,” and “Set Your Hope,” are jam-packed with divine instructions that can change us from pew-sitters to anointed-doers! All of this can only happen due to God’s grace and the revelation of the Word and Spirit of God! So today, I must be ready for action while having a clear mind and a hopeful heart. This is the day that the LORD has made! I’m in by His choice, and it’s front-loaded with His Goodness, Blessings, and opportunities to do His Bidding! LORD make it so. Awaken me to Your Will, use me for Your Glory, and help me stay focused on what You Desire.

INSIDE OUT

A serious pursuit of godliness requires an equally serious renunciation of worldliness. Too often, we measure spirituality with false scales. While being wisely selective with our public vices we are less so with our private attitudes and perspectives. In reality, it is the thoughts and intents of the heart where the greatest battles must be waged; our actions will ultimately align with the condition of our hearts. Lord God, You know me inside out, You are not fooled by human facades. Plow my heart with Your Word and Spirit and leave nothing unturned. Refresh my inward man that I may outwardly glorify You in all places at all times.

HEARTBREAKS

Every soul experiences heartbreaks. Heartaches accumulate and develop tentacles that reach deep into our whole being. Particularly painful is the regret associated with perceived failures. Heartbreaks, failures and the remorse they foster do us no good unless they become motivation for learning, change and growth. People often let heartbreaks simmer too long which leads to hardening of the heart, but heartaches placed into the Master’s hands become pathways for spiritual progress. Lord, You make all things new. I’m joyfully growing, one heartache at a time. Use me as healing balm to others whose hearts are broken. 

THE LORD IS ONE

Usage of the phrases “My God” and “Our God” in songs and conversations among believers has gone far afield from the Biblical context in which they were used. These seemingly innocent attempts to describe our relationship with Elohim must only be spoken with keen Scriptural understanding: “I am the Lord, there is no other, apart from me there is no God.” Plain and simple, to even imply that He is but one choice among many is fundamentally false. In a world of increasing polytheism we must be clear, the LORD is One, He stands alone as King of the Universe, Creator of All Things. Holy LORD, let my life declare boldly, You Alone are Almighty God.
